Free salon celebrates launch of new book about 50 of Harrogate’s architectural treasures
The Chapel’s owner Mark Hinchliffe is hosting a free salon on 18 October to launch a new book by local author Malcolm Neesam. Harrogate in 50 Buildings examines the architectural treasures of this famous Yorkshire spa and it includes The … Continue reading
